The rectangle rotates around one of its sides, equal to 8cm. The lateral surface area of the cylinder obtained during rotation is 256pi cm2. Find the area of the rectangle.

Let the rectangle ABO1O rotate around the side OO1, then AB = СD = h = OO1 = 8 cm.

The AO segment is the radius of the circle and the unknown side of the rectangle. AO = R.

The lateral surface area of the cylinder is:

Side = 2 * π * R * AB = 2 * π * R * 8 = 16 * π * R = 256 * π cm2.

R = AO = 256 * π / 16 * π = 256/16 = 16 cm.

Then Savo1o = AO * AB = 16 * 8 = 128 cm2.

Answer: The area of the rectangle is 128 cm2.
